La Sportiva Freccia Short
It turns out, Freccia means “arrow” in Italian so that should give you an idea of this short’s intentions - straight to the top. The La Sportiva Freccia is a minimalist short that focuses on freedom of movement while running so you have one less thing to worry about. It’s perfect for uneven terrain, scrambles, alpine environments, and hard-to-reach summits. Four-way stretch side inserts, mesh pockets, and a no-bulk, adjustable waistband all prove the point. Other details such as Polygiene-treated inner brief, flatlock seam construction, and hits of reflectivity only add to the Freccia’s capabilities. La Sportiva hit the bullseye with this one.
- No-bulk, adjustable waistband for happy hips.
- Polygiene treated brief reduces any funk.
- Flatlock seam construction prevents dreaded clothing chafe.
- 4-way stretchy side inserts don’t restrict your movement when you need it most.
